MEATLOAF HOMES LTD - Analysis Report
Company Number: 13005519
Analysis Date: 2025-07-20 13:19 UTC
Risk Rating: HIGH
The company's financial structure indicates significant solvency and liquidity risks. The total liabilities due after more than one year (£689,883) nearly match the fixed assets (£714,183), while net current assets have turned negative (£-12,287 in 2023). The minimal current assets (£1,478) against high current liabilities (£689,883) suggest potential cash flow constraints. Although the company is active, the micro-entity status with no employees and limited equity signals operational fragility.Key Concerns:
- High Leverage and Debt Maturity Profile: Long-term creditors nearly equal fixed assets, indicating heavy reliance on debt financing and limited equity buffer (£12,013).
- Negative Net Current Assets: The working capital position is negative, suggesting difficulties in meeting short-term obligations without additional financing.
- Lack of Operational Activity: Zero employees reported, minimal current assets, and no revenue or turnover data provided raise concerns on the company’s ability to generate operational cash flow to service debt.
- Positive Indicators:
- Consistent Fixed Asset Base: Fixed assets remain stable at £714,183 over multiple years, implying asset retention which could potentially be leveraged or sold if needed.
- No Overdue Filings: The company’s accounts and confirmation statements are up to date, indicating compliance with regulatory filing requirements.
- Single Controlling Shareholder: Mr Neil Christopher Anderson’s full ownership and director status could facilitate swift decision-making.
- Due Diligence Notes:
- Clarify Nature of Long-Term Creditors: Investigate the composition, terms, and covenants of the £689,883 long-term liabilities to assess refinancing risk and creditor demands.
- Review Cash Flow Statements: Obtain cash flow data to understand liquidity dynamics and the company’s ability to meet short-term and long-term obligations.
- Assess Business Model and Revenue Streams: Confirm how the company generates income, especially given zero employees and micro-entity status, to evaluate operational sustainability.
- Examine Fixed Asset Valuation: Verify if fixed assets are tangible and realizable at stated values to support solvency assessments.
- Director’s Strategy and Plans: Engage with management to understand plans to improve liquidity and reduce debt burden.
